A Tea to Detoxify the Body of Synthetic Hormones

Synthetic hormones, present in pesticides, plastics and other manmade chemicals, cause a health hazard when they mimic estrogen in your body. Known as xenoestrogens, these chemicals are pervasive throughout the environment and are found in people and places where there is no history of their use. Synthetic hormone exposure can lead to endocrine imbalance. A variety of herbal teas can help your body process and dispose of synthetic hormones
